Legalities
 
The legal status of the pay for sex in East End market varies considerably around the world, with some countries adopting a more permissive method, while others impose strict penalties or perhaps criminalize the act entirely.
 
Decriminalization: In some jurisdictions, such as New Zealand, the act of exchanging sex for cash is not considered illegal, and sex work is dealt with as a genuine profession. This approach has been praised for focusing on the security and rights of sex workers.
 
Legalization: Nations such as Germany and the Netherlands have actually legalized prostitution and executed policies to govern the market, such as obligatory registration, medical examination, and taxation. Advocates argue that this technique helps reduce exploitation and human trafficking.
 
Criminalization: In other parts of the world, such as the United States (with the exception of some counties in Nevada) and much of Africa, Asia, and the Middle East, both the buying and selling of sex are strictly restricted and punishable by law.
